Understanding Registered Representatives within Washington
A registered agent for the state of Washington plays a key role for businesses, especially LLCs. This specific person or organization acts as a point of contact to official documents, such as legal notifications, tax documents, and compliance communications from the state. Having a designated agent ensures that your business remains in compliance with the law and steers clear of potential issues, such as overlooking important deadlines or not receiving court documents.
In Washington, the designated representative must have a actual address within the state and be accessible during standard business hours to handle these important communications. This requirement helps facilitate timely and efficient communication between your company and state authorities. Washington Registered Agent Requirements
In WA, a designated agent is a vital component for any organization, including LLCs and incorporated entities. The designated agent must have a real street address in the state of Washington, which will serve as the designated point for receiving legal documents, notifications, and government correspondence. This address cannot be a post office box; it must be a physical location where the registered agent can be contacted during regular business hours.
The registered agent can be an in-state individual of Washington, such as a owner of the business or an worker, or a designated agent service that is permitted to conduct business in the state. If a company chooses a provider, it is important to select a service that meets the state's criteria and follows state law.
Additionally, registered agents in Washington must be on duty during normal working hours to ensure that they can accept court summons and other crucial alerts whenever they arise. Businesses are also responsible for keeping their registered agent information up to date, and neglect to do so can lead to compliance issues, including fines.
Altering Your Registered Agent in Washington
Changing your registered agent in Washington is a simple process, but it demands attention to detail to ensure that everything is in order. To begin registered agent appointment , you are required to submit a Change of Registered Agent application with the State of Washington Secretary of State. This form can generally be processed electronically or by posting a physical form. It is essential to have the necessary data, including the name of the incoming registered agent and their contact information, ready before filing.
Once you have submitted the form, your new registered agent will be officially appointed to handle official correspondence and communications on behalf of your business. It is vital to notify your former registered agent of the change to eliminate any problems in receiving critical documents during the changeover. Additionally, confirm that your replacement appointed agent is aware of their obligations, as they will have a crucial role in upholding your organization's adherence with legal obligations.
Keep in mind that there may be a minimal fee involved in changing your appointed agent in the State of Washington. It is recommended to check the latest costs listed on the Secretary of State's website for up-to-date data. Also, be aware of any due dates related to yearly filing submissions or compliance requirements to ensure that your business remains in compliance while implementing this change.
